Assessing the Situation: DIY or Professional Intervention?

Before you reach for your spanner, it's crucial to evaluate the nature of the problem and your own mechanical aptitude. Some generator issues are relatively straightforward and can be resolved with basic tools and knowledge, while others require specialised equipment, diagnostic skills, and a deep understanding of electrical and mechanical systems. Safety should always be your paramount concern.

When DIY Might Be Possible

Minor issues, often related to fuel, oil, or air intake, can frequently be addressed by a competent individual. These typically include:

  • Low Fuel/Oil Levels: This is perhaps the simplest fix. Ensure your generator has adequate, fresh fuel and the oil level is correct according to the manufacturer's specifications. Stale fuel is a common culprit for starting issues, especially in portable units that sit idle for extended periods.
  • Clogged Air Filters: If your generator operates in dusty environments (like construction sites or farms), its air filter can quickly become clogged. Cleaning or replacing a dirty air filter can often resolve performance issues.
  • Spark Plug Issues: A fouled or worn spark plug can prevent a generator from starting or running smoothly. Replacing a spark plug is a relatively simple task for most DIYers.
  • Loose Connections (Non-Electrical): Checking for and tightening any loose mechanical connections or fasteners can sometimes resolve vibration or minor operational quirks.

Always consult your generator's owner's manual for specific instructions and safety precautions before attempting any of these basic maintenance or repair tasks.

Signs You Need a Professional

For more complex or electrical issues, professional assistance is not just recommended, but often essential. Attempting to fix intricate problems without the proper training and tools can be dangerous and may void your warranty. You should definitely call a professional if you experience:

  • Electrical Malfunctions: Faulty wiring, tripped breakers that won't reset, or issues with the output voltage are serious electrical problems that require expert diagnosis and repair.
  • Engine Problems: Beyond basic fuel/oil issues, if your generator is making unusual noises, smoking excessively, or has significant coolant leaks, it indicates a deeper engine problem.
  • Rotor or Stator Issues: Problems with the generator's rotating (rotor) or stationary (stator) components are highly specialised repairs.
  • Persistent Starting Problems: If you've addressed fuel, oil, and spark plug issues and the generator still won't start, or if there's a suspected loss of residual magnetism, a technician can properly diagnose the electrical system.
  • Component Replacement: If major components are burnt, damaged, or broken, and require replacement (beyond simple filters or spark plugs), a professional can source the correct parts and install them safely.

Common Generator Malfunctions and Their Solutions

Understanding the typical issues that plague generators can help you identify whether you're facing a simple fix or a more serious problem requiring expert attention. Generators, whether portable, inverter, or standby, have common failure points, but also specific vulnerabilities based on their design and intended use.

Portable Generator Peculiarities

Compact and versatile, portable generators are ideal for powering tools, camping trips, or providing temporary backup. One of their most frequent drawbacks is a starting problem, often attributed to stale fuel. Modern petrol can degrade rapidly, especially if left in the tank for months, leading to gumming up the carburettor. Another less common but possible cause for starting issues is a loss of residual magnetism, which prevents the generator from building an initial electrical charge. This specific issue almost always requires professional intervention to re-flash the field.

Inverter and Standby Generator Issues

Inverter generators provide cleaner power and are more fuel-efficient, while standby generators are designed for automatic, continuous backup power. Both types, being more sophisticated, can suffer from a range of issues:

  • Coolant Leaks: Essential for engine cooling, leaks can lead to overheating and severe engine damage if not addressed promptly.
  • Faulty Wirings: Loose, corroded, or damaged wiring can cause intermittent power, no power output, or even fire hazards.
  • Dead Batteries: Standby generators rely on a battery for starting. A dead or weak battery will prevent the unit from firing up during an outage. Regular battery checks are vital.
  • Low Fuel and Oil Levels: While seemingly obvious, neglecting these can lead to the generator shutting down or sustaining significant engine damage.

The Critical Role of the Rotor

The rotor is a crucial, moving component within your generator, responsible for converting mechanical motion into electrical energy. Due to the high speeds and electrical currents involved, rotors are susceptible to overheating, mechanical failures, and thermal stresses, especially if overused or improperly maintained. When a rotor fails, it often requires specialist attention. Generator rotor repair experts can rebuild and recondition failed rotors, which may involve removing retaining rings, replacing field poles, and addressing any damage to the windings. Should the need arise, they can also provide efficient generator winding repairs and install new coppers, restoring the generator's electrical output capabilities.

Essential Generator Maintenance for Longevity

Preventative maintenance is the cornerstone of generator longevity and reliability. Regular servicing can prevent costly breakdowns, extend the life of your unit, and ensure it's ready when you need it most. It's always wise to get periodic maintenance so you can fully maximise the benefits of your generator during blackouts and emergencies.

Regular Checks and Servicing

You can choose between weekly, monthly, or annual maintenance services, depending on the manufacturer's recommendations and your usage frequency. A comprehensive maintenance routine typically involves:

  • Fluid Level Checks: Regularly checking and topping up engine oil, coolant, and fuel levels.
  • Filter Inspection/Replacement: Checking and replacing air, fuel, and oil filters as needed.
  • Battery Testing: Ensuring the starting battery is charged and in good condition, especially for standby units.
  • Visual Inspection: Looking for any signs of wear, corrosion, leaks (coolant, oil, fuel), or loose connections.
  • Fuel Cleaning/Stabilisation: For portable units, using fuel stabiliser or draining fuel for long-term storage can prevent stale fuel issues.
  • Load Bank Testing: For larger or standby generators, periodically running the unit under a simulated load ensures it can perform at its rated capacity when called upon. Professionals often perform this.
  • Component Wear Assessment: Identifying any worn-out or corroded parts that may need replacement before they cause a failure.

While some maintenance tasks can be done by the owner, a professional service often includes thorough diagnostics and adjustments that ensure optimal performance and catch potential problems early.

Frequently Asked Questions (FAQs)

Q: How often should I service my generator?

A: The frequency depends on your generator's type, usage, and the manufacturer's recommendations. Lightly used portable generators might need annual servicing, while standby generators typically require professional maintenance every six months or annually, plus regular owner checks.

Q: Can a generator be repaired on site?

A: Yes, many common generator repairs and maintenance tasks can be carried out on site by mobile technicians. This is particularly convenient for larger standby units that are difficult to transport. More extensive repairs, like major engine overhauls or rotor rewinding, might require the unit to be taken to a repair centre.

Q: Is it worth repairing an old generator?

A: It depends on the age, condition, and cost of the repair versus replacement. For significant issues, compare the repair estimate to the cost of a new, more efficient model. Minor issues are usually worth repairing. A professional assessment can help you make an informed decision.

Q: What is loss of residual magnetism in a generator?

A: Residual magnetism is a small amount of magnetism retained in the generator's rotor, which is essential to initiate the voltage build-up when the generator starts. If this magnetism is lost (e.g., due to long storage or vibration), the generator won't produce power. It typically requires 'flashing the field' or 'exciting the field' by applying an external DC current, a task best left to professionals.

Q: How can I prevent stale fuel issues in my portable generator?

A: Use fresh fuel, ideally no older than 30 days. For longer storage, use a fuel stabiliser in the tank or drain the fuel completely before storing the generator. Running the generator dry of fuel can also prevent gumming in the carburettor.
